On the down side, as you already mentioned, the mix was pretty scrambled. I am listening through DT770 Pro headphones, so I hear a pretty truthful rendition of what is in your DAW. I have a couple of suggestions, but I am not a pro at mixing either.
Maybe the guitars could use a little wider stereo field so they wouldn't be on top of each other. Pan one far right, the other far left. And maybe roll off the lower harmonics of both guitars so the bass could breathe a bit more. Not enough to change the tone, just enough to kill any harmonics that compete with the bass ans kick.
